阿里云服务器下文件卡顿问题可能由多种原因引起,包括网络带宽不足、服务器负载过高、文件服务器配置不当等,为解决此问题,可采取以下措施:优化网络带宽,确保网络畅通;优化服务器配置,提高服务器性能;定期清理无用文件,释放存储空间;采用分布式文件系统,提高文件访问效率,还需定期检查服务器状态,及时发现并解决问题,通过这些措施,可有效解决阿里云文件服务器卡顿问题,提升用户体验。
在数字化时代,云计算已成为企业运营和个人开发不可或缺的一部分,阿里云作为全球领先的云服务提供商,其服务器被广泛应用于各种场景中,有时用户可能会遇到阿里云服务器上的文件操作卡顿问题,这不仅影响了工作效率,还可能对业务连续性造成威胁,本文将深入探讨阿里云服务器下文件卡顿的可能原因,并提供相应的解决方案,帮助用户优化使用体验。
文件卡顿的常见原因
-
磁盘I/O瓶颈:当服务器上的磁盘读写请求超过其处理能力时,会导致文件操作延迟增加,出现卡顿现象,这通常发生在大量数据读写或高并发访问的场景中。
-
网络延迟:虽然阿里云提供了稳定的高速网络连接,但网络延迟或带宽不足仍可能导致远程文件访问速度下降。
-
文件系统问题:文件系统损坏、配置不当或过度碎片化都可能影响文件操作的效率。
-
资源争用:多个进程同时访问同一文件或目录时,如果资源没有得到有效管理,会导致冲突和性能下降。
-
安全软件干预:某些安全软件(如防病毒软件)可能会扫描所有文件操作,从而增加处理时间,导致卡顿。
解决方案与优化策略
优化磁盘I/O性能
- 升级硬盘:考虑将机械硬盘(HDD)升级为固态硬盘(SSD),因为SSD的读写速度远快于HDD,能有效提升I/O性能。
- RAID配置:利用RAID技术(如RAID 0、RAID 1、RAID 5等)可以提高数据冗余度和读写效率,减少单点故障对性能的影响。
- 调整I/O调度器:根据工作负载特性,选择合适的I/O调度算法(如deadline、noop等),以优化磁盘访问模式。
减少网络延迟
- 选择合适的网络类型:根据业务需求选择更高速的网络服务,如阿里云的高带宽网络或VPC内网通信。
- 优化数据传输:使用压缩工具或算法减少数据传输量,加快传输速度。
- CDN加速:对于静态资源,利用CDN进行内容分发,减少源站压力并提高访问速度。
文件系统优化与维护
- 定期维护:执行文件系统检查(fsck)、清理无用文件和碎片整理,保持文件系统健康。
- 选择合适的文件系统:根据使用场景选择高效的文件系统,如EXT4、XFS等。
- 挂载选项优化:调整挂载参数,如
noatime
、nodiratime
减少文件系统更新频率,提高性能。
资源管理与调度
- 资源隔离:使用cgroup、namespace等技术隔离不同应用的资源使用,避免相互干扰。
- 限制进程:合理设置进程优先级和限制,确保关键任务得到足够的资源。
- 负载均衡:在高并发场景下,采用负载均衡技术分散请求,减轻单一服务器的压力。
安全管理优化
- 禁用不必要的安全扫描:评估并关闭或调整不频繁访问文件的防病毒扫描,以减少系统开销。
- 权限管理:严格管理文件和目录的访问权限,减少不必要的权限提升操作。
- 监控与日志:实施有效的监控和日志记录策略,及时发现并处理安全问题,同时避免过度记录影响性能。
总结与展望
阿里云服务器下文件卡顿问题可能由多种因素引起,但通过针对性的优化措施,可以显著提升文件操作的效率和稳定性,随着云计算技术的不断发展和硬件性能的持续提升,相信这类问题将得到更好的解决,对于用户而言,持续关注和优化服务器配置及运行环境,是保持高效业务运行的关键,合理利用阿里云提供的各种工具和资源,如云监控、性能诊断等,也是解决和优化问题的有效途径。